People wearing face masks wait to order food at a fast-food restaurant during the novel coronavirus (COVID-19) pandemic in Toronto, Ontario, Canada on August 22, 2021. Ontario's daily COVID-19 case count continues to move upward to levels not seen in more than two months, with officials reporting 722 cases on Sunday and two additional deaths. 522 or 78 per cent of Sunday's cases involved people who were unvaccinated, partially vaccinated or had an unknown vaccination status. 158 or 22 per cent of Sunday's case count involved fully vaccinated individuals.
